Output e14ed94ddf15b9943392662f240bca2e24412f4efe44fa7cf7a9478b7822fe28:0

value
10517054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81587a62153df4969347fce62631c7860fba486 OP_EQUAL
address
3H1mEhB4Henrq8JNavyJu14dv1P6qXMwpZ
transaction
e14ed94ddf15b9943392662f240bca2e24412f4efe44fa7cf7a9478b7822fe28
spent
true